Driving Innovation and Trust: Ten’s Journey to Redefine Service Excellence  

Ten is on a mission to become the most trusted service business in the world. Technology-driven Product is at the centre of our strategy to create a hugely successful service and business.  Millions of members already have access to Ten's services across lifestyle, travel, dining and entertainment on behalf of over fifty clients including HSBC, Swisscard, Visa, Mastercard and American Express. Ten's partnerships are based on multi-year contracts generating revenue through platform-as-a-service and technology fees.  

We have the advantages of already being at scale globally with a critical mass of high-net-worth members via stable, multi-year revenue-generating contracts.  We already have a market leading consumer proposition and credibility (and many integrations) with the leading suppliers/partners across our ‘big 4’ service categories of restaurants/travel/entertainment and luxury retail.    

We are debt-free, profitable and the first B Corp listed on the London Stock Exchange (AIM market).  

Our plans are to continue to invest into technology (including AI) to become the main way that our members organise their leisure lives. The next few years will see Ten speed up our progress via our Growth Engine strategy  making the next huge steps to achieve our ambitions together.

The role

We are a growing team navigating an exciting phase of digital transformation. We’re expanding our Product Management function and are looking for a Senior Product Manager. You will work closely with Product Design and Engineering across Cape Town, London - UK, and Katowice - Poland, bringing a strategic, user-centric focus to our Products. 

There will be ambiguity as we define our best practices, but for the right Product Manager, this is a unique opportunity to shape how product operates at a global scale without being micromanaged. 

With an inventory of over 650,000 hotels, 70,000 restaurants, and global event tickets, helping our members find exactly what they want is a massive challenge. You will own the "Discovery" experience: Search, Merchandising, Ranking algorithms, and Personalization, leveraging AI to surface the perfect recommendations.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Strategic Ownership: Define the long-term vision and roadmap for the search and discovery experience across the platform, optimizing ranking algorithms to ensure highly relevant, premium results. 
  • AI & Personalization: Champion the use of member data and AI/ML to build dynamic, personalized discovery feeds, surfacing relevant content, offers, and inventory proactively. 
  • Merchandising Innovation: Build robust tools and features that allow us to highlight curated collections, seasonal campaigns, and exclusive partnerships effectively. 
  • Data-Driven Leadership: Define and track core discovery metrics (e.g., search-to-click, click-to-book, zero-result searches) and run rigorous, complex experiments to improve content discoverability. 
  • Cross-Functional Mentorship: Partner closely with Data Science, Engineering, and Design to turn massive datasets into an intuitive, luxurious browsing experience, while mentoring junior PMs on best practices.

What We Do

Ten Lifestyle Group is a global travel and lifestyle concierge company that partners with financial institutions and premium brands to provide services like travel, dining, and entertainment to their clients and members.
